How are Tortilla and Sunflower oil different?

  • Tortilla is richer in Iron, Vitamin B1, Selenium, Vitamin B3, Folate, Phosphorus, and Manganese, while Sunflower oil is higher in Vitamin E .
  • Sunflower oil covers your daily need of Vitamin E 273% more than Tortilla.
  • Sunflower oil is lower in Sodium.

Tortilla, includes plain and from mutton sandwich (Navajo) and Oil, sunflower, linoleic, (partially hydrogenated) types were used in this article.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Tortilla Sunflower oil Opinion
Net carbs 47.54g 0g Tortilla
Protein 7.28g 0g Tortilla
Fats 0.95g 100g Sunflower oil
Carbs 49.94g 0g Tortilla
Calories 237kcal 884kcal Sunflower oil
Starch 43.02g Tortilla
Sugar 2.75g 0g Sunflower oil
Fiber 2.4g 0g Tortilla
Calcium 70mg 0mg Tortilla
Iron 3.81mg 0mg Tortilla
Magnesium 19mg 0mg Tortilla
Phosphorus 146mg 0mg Tortilla
Potassium 105mg 0mg Tortilla
Sodium 482mg 0mg Sunflower oil
Zinc 0.32mg 0mg Tortilla
Copper 0.102mg 0mg Tortilla
Manganese 0.268mg 0mg Tortilla
Selenium 16.6µg 0µg Tortilla
Vitamin E 0.19mg 41.08mg Sunflower oil
Vitamin B1 0.37mg 0mg Tortilla
Vitamin B2 0.114mg 0mg Tortilla
Vitamin B3 4.125mg 0mg Tortilla
Vitamin B5 0.17mg 0mg Tortilla
Vitamin B6 0.06mg 0mg Tortilla
Folate 98µg 0µg Tortilla
Vitamin K 0.4µg 5.4µg Sunflower oil
Tryptophan 0.06mg 0mg Tortilla
Threonine 0.182mg 0mg Tortilla
Isoleucine 0.286mg 0mg Tortilla
Leucine 0.53mg 0mg Tortilla
Lysine 0.157mg 0mg Tortilla
Methionine 0.122mg 0mg Tortilla
Phenylalanine 0.375mg 0mg Tortilla
Valine 0.326mg 0mg Tortilla
Histidine 0.165mg 0mg Tortilla
Saturated Fat 0.296g 13g Tortilla
Monounsaturated Fat 0.185g 46.2g Sunflower oil
Polyunsaturated fat 0.391g 36.4g Sunflower oil
Omega-3 - ALA 0.019g Tortilla
